Navigating WordPress Vulnerabilities: Essential Insights for Website Security

Table of Contents

  1. Key Highlights:
  2. Introduction
  3. The Current State of WordPress Vulnerabilities
  4. Understanding Vulnerabilities: The Types and Their Consequences
  5. The Importance of Regular Updates and Maintenance
  6. Best Practices for Securing WordPress Sites
  7. The Role of the Community in Vulnerability Disclosure
  8. The Future of WordPress Security
  9. FAQ

Key Highlights:

  • A total of 109 vulnerabilities have been disclosed, with 65 receiving security patches. Website administrators are urged to implement these updates promptly.
  • Among the disclosed vulnerabilities, 44 remain unpatched, putting WordPress installations at risk. Users are encouraged to deactivate affected plugins or themes if no fix is forthcoming.
  • As cyberattacks become more sophisticated, vulnerable plugins and themes are among the leading causes of WordPress website breaches, particularly targeting small to mid-sized businesses.

Introduction

The digital landscape continues to evolve, and with it, the threat landscape for website security. WordPress, powering over 40% of all websites globally, remains a significant target for cybercriminals due to its extensive use of plugins and themes, many of which can harbor vulnerabilities. Recent reports highlight a concerning rise in the number of reported vulnerabilities within WordPress plugins and themes, emphasizing the urgent need for website administrators to prioritize security measures. This article delves into the latest findings regarding WordPress vulnerabilities, the implications for website security, and best practices for mitigating risks.

The Current State of WordPress Vulnerabilities

In a recent vulnerability report, 109 vulnerabilities were disclosed, underscoring the pressing need for WordPress users to stay informed and proactive. Among these, 65 vulnerabilities have received patches, meaning updates are available that address the identified security flaws. The responsibility falls on website administrators to apply these updates swiftly to safeguard against potential breaches.

However, the situation is more dire for the remaining 44 vulnerabilities, which currently lack patches. Without timely fixes from plugin or theme developers, WordPress administrators face heightened risks. Solid Security Pro users benefit from virtual patching services that protect against high or medium-risk vulnerabilities, but reliance on such services should not substitute for routine maintenance and updates.

Understanding Vulnerabilities: The Types and Their Consequences

The vulnerabilities disclosed can be categorized based on their severity and type. Common vulnerabilities include:

SQL Injection

SQL injection vulnerabilities allow attackers to manipulate an application’s database through malicious SQL statements. This can lead to unauthorized access to sensitive data, deletion of database entries, or even complete control over the database. For instance, the URL Shortener Plugin for WordPress has been found to have critical SQL injection vulnerabilities, putting its users at significant risk.

Cross-Site Scripting (XSS)

Cross-site scripting vulnerabilities enable attackers to inject malicious scripts into web pages viewed by users. This can lead to session hijacking, defacement of websites, or redirection to malicious sites. The Contact Form 7 Editor Button plugin is one example that has been flagged for XSS vulnerabilities, highlighting the risks associated with poorly maintained or outdated plugins.

PHP Object Injection

This vulnerability type allows attackers to exploit code paths that handle serialized PHP objects. By injecting malicious objects, attackers can manipulate the application’s behavior, potentially leading to arbitrary code execution. Vulnerabilities in various plugins, including the previously mentioned URL Shortener Plugin, showcase this risk.

The Importance of Regular Updates and Maintenance

Regular updates and maintenance are crucial in protecting WordPress installations from vulnerabilities. The WordPress community actively works on patching known vulnerabilities, and these updates are typically rolled out in maintenance releases. For example, the recent release of WordPress 6.8.2 addressed 20 core tickets and 15 block editor issues, further enhancing the platform’s security and functionality.

Website administrators must establish a routine for checking and applying updates, focusing not only on the core WordPress files but also on plugins and themes. The Solid Security Pro tool offers features that can assist in managing these updates, but manual checks should remain a part of any comprehensive security strategy.

Best Practices for Securing WordPress Sites

While keeping plugins and themes up to date is essential, there are additional steps that WordPress administrators can take to enhance their site’s security:

Deactivate Unused Plugins and Themes

One of the most effective ways to reduce risk is to deactivate and remove any plugins or themes that are not actively in use. Each additional plugin or theme introduces potential vulnerabilities, so minimizing the number of installed extensions can significantly improve security.

Utilize Security Plugins

Employing dedicated security plugins can provide an additional layer of protection. These plugins often include features such as firewalls, malware scanning, and login attempt tracking, which can help thwart attacks before they escalate.

Regular Backups

Regular backups are essential for recovery in the event of a security breach. Automated backup solutions can ensure that website data is regularly saved, allowing for quick restoration if necessary.

Implement Strong Password Policies

Weak user account security remains a prevalent issue among WordPress sites. Administrators should enforce strong password policies and consider two-factor authentication to enhance login security.

Monitor User Activity

Keeping an eye on user activity can help identify unauthorized access or suspicious behavior early on. Security plugins often include user activity logs, which can provide insights into potential security incidents.

The Role of the Community in Vulnerability Disclosure

Responsible disclosure of vulnerabilities is vital in maintaining the integrity of the WordPress ecosystem. Developers and security professionals are encouraged to report vulnerabilities to the affected parties before making them public. This practice not only aids in developing patches but also fosters a culture of safety within the community.

Website administrators are urged to share information regarding vulnerabilities and patches within their networks and communities. By spreading awareness, the overall security posture of WordPress sites can be enhanced.

The Future of WordPress Security

As the sophistication of cyberattacks increases, the WordPress community must remain vigilant. The ongoing development of plugins, themes, and core WordPress files will continue to introduce new features, but this must be balanced with robust security practices.

The collaboration between developers, security professionals, and users is paramount. By remaining informed and proactive, the WordPress community can work together to mitigate risks and protect their websites from emerging threats.

FAQ

What should I do if my plugin has a vulnerability that isn’t patched?

If a plugin has a known vulnerability without an available patch, it is advisable to deactivate it immediately and seek alternative solutions. Relying on a plugin that could be exploited poses a significant risk to your website’s security.

How can I check if my WordPress site is secure?

Conduct regular security audits of your website, focusing on plugin and theme vulnerabilities. Utilize security plugins that offer scanning and monitoring features to detect potential threats.

Are there any specific plugins recommended for enhancing WordPress security?

Several security plugins are highly regarded in the WordPress community, including Wordfence, Sucuri Security, and iThemes Security. Each offers a variety of features designed to protect your site.

What are the risks of not updating WordPress regularly?

Failing to update WordPress can leave your site vulnerable to known exploits. Cybercriminals often target outdated installations, making regular updates essential for maintaining security.

How often should I back up my WordPress website?

The frequency of backups can depend on how often you update your site or add new content. For active sites, daily backups may be advisable, while less active sites may only require weekly backups.

By implementing these best practices and staying informed about emerging vulnerabilities, WordPress administrators can significantly enhance their website’s security and resilience against cyber threats.

Leave a Reply

Your email address will not be published. Required fields are marked *

Time limit is exhausted. Please reload the CAPTCHA.